Don't own a dog, but I think I know some. Most can be translated quite literally: Zit - Sit, Af - lay/ lie, Op/ sta - stand up, Blijf - stay, Hier - come here, Braaf - good boy. Reply Voet and volg (en) can both be used in IPO for heel command. Most common in KNPV is volg (en) for heel and plaats for heelposition (no required commands, you are free to choose tourown as long it has to do with the exercise you're performing. www.vanleeuwen-hollandseherders.nl. Selena van Leeuwen. Choochi.Start by saying the new German command. If you want your dog to learn both, you can follow it with the known English command. For instance, say "platz" followed by "down" and then praise and reward your dog for complying. Repeat multiple times in different environments. When your dog gets it, give plenty of praise.You’re essentially training her to go to her crate or mat when you ask her to. Give your dog a treat as you put down a mat or a bed. Put a treat to your dog’s nose and run with her to the mat, saying, “Go to place.”. Reward her on the mat.
